Acoustic engineering masters programs teach students the principles of acoustic science and engineering and provide them with the advanced knowledge required to design, analyze, and implement audio systems for a variety of purposes. Acoustic engineers are equipped with the skills to identify noise-related problems and develop solutions that minimize the impact produced by sound. With an acoustic engineering masters program, students gain proficiency in acoustics, signal processing, control system design, and psychoacoustics.

What topics are covered in an acoustic engineering masters program?
An acoustic engineering masters program covers topics such as acoustics, signal processing, control system design, and psychoacoustics.
What types of projects do students may work on during an acoustic engineering masters program?
During an acoustic engineering masters program, students can expect to work on projects related to designing audio systems for various applications, analyzing noise control strategies, developing methods for minimizing sound in specific environments, or improving audio technologies.
What type of careers can graduates pursue after completing an acoustic engineering master's degree?
Graduates from an acoustic engineering master's degree program can pursue career paths such as audio engineer, sound designer for video games or films, field service engineer for medical device companies, consultant measuring environmental noise levels or auditorium acoustics.
